A lodge employee has urged friends to not leap straight onto the mattress after checking into their rooms. Whereas a cushty double mattress or bigger might seem tempting, conducting a couple of inspections beforehand may show worthwhile, in response to Natalie Brookson.
The 37-year-old, who has spent years working in hospitality, mentioned she was left “horrified” after discovering the minimal consideration paid to mattress bugs.

In response to her, inspections for mattress bugs have been performed in simply 10 per cent of rooms on the chain the place she was employed.
“If you happen to thought the little critters have been incessantly checked for in lodge rooms, you would be incorrect,” she mentioned.
Talking to Lady’s Personal Journal, Natalie inspired lodge friends to carry out their very own complete checks earlier than getting comfy.

Resort (Picture: Holding baggage away from bed may also help cut back the chance of bringing mattress bugs house)
To establish mattress bugs, she really useful inspecting the seams of the mattress and any buttons intently, as these are the areas the place they sometimes cover themselves and lay their eggs. Small blood marks on the sheets can even sign their presence, she warned.
Normal steerage suggests checking confined, hid areas resembling mattress seams and labels, mattress body joints, the headboard (each entrance and rear), behind bedside furnishings, inside cracks in partitions or skirting boards, and round electrical sockets or image frames.
In additional extreme infestations, there can also be a sugary, musty scent, paying homage to damp towels. In the meantime, must you suspect you’ve introduced mattress bugs house out of your travels, Martin Seeley, CEO of MattressNextDay, has provided steerage on act swiftly.
He mentioned: “If you happen to imagine you’ve introduced mattress bugs house out of your vacation, it is necessary to take care of the infestation right away.
“These small, flat pip-like bugs feed on human blood, forsaking itchy bites and probably triggering allergic reactions.”
He went on to warn: “Nevertheless, what many individuals are unaware of is that they are in a position to survive for as much as a 12 months with out feeding on any blood, making it straightforward for a single mattress bug to shortly escalate right into a full-blown infestation.”
Martin additional cautioned that feminine mattress bugs are able to laying between 200 and 500 eggs throughout a two-month interval, in batches of 10 to 50, which means infestations can spiral way more quickly than most individuals would ever anticipate. “The eggs themselves are sticky and may connect to furnishings, clothes and different gadgets, spreading them additional too,” he added.
To fight this, he suggests holding baggage away from the mattress and storing private belongings in drawers wherever doable.
Martin additionally recommends that travellers pack a devoted laundry bag for dirty clothes and seal it as tightly as doable.
